Narrative:
Mosquito DD???/Q: Took off at 17:50 hrs for GCI East Hill patrol. 30/01/1943
Returned early due to Generator u/s. Landed Ok at 18:00 hrs..
Crew:
P/O (86574) Edward Richard HEDGECOE (pilot) RAFVR - Ok
Sgt (1450589) James Richard WITHAM (nav.) RAFVR - Ok
